Business Performance Review

Document background
The Business Performance Review document is essential for organizations operating in Denmark that need to conduct structured employee evaluations in compliance with local employment laws and data protection requirements. It is typically used during annual or semi-annual review cycles to document employee performance, set objectives, and plan professional development. The document includes sections for objective performance metrics, competency assessments, and development planning, while incorporating Danish workplace values of dialogue and consensus. It serves both as a legal record and a management tool, helping organizations maintain consistent evaluation standards while respecting Danish labor market practices and collective agreements. The document is designed to support constructive feedback discussions and career development planning while ensuring compliance with Danish regulatory requirements regarding employee documentation and data protection.
Suggested Sections

1. Parties: Identification of the reviewing manager and employee being reviewed

2. Background: Context of the review including employee's role, department, and review period

3. Definitions: Key terms used in the review document including performance metrics and rating scales

4. Review Period: Specific timeframe covered by the performance review

5. Performance Objectives Review: Assessment of achievement against previously set objectives

6. Key Performance Indicators: Evaluation of measurable performance metrics

7. Competency Assessment: Review of core competencies and skills required for the role

8. Development and Training: Review of completed training and development activities

9. Future Objectives: Setting of new objectives for the next review period

10. Action Plan: Specific steps agreed for performance improvement or development

11. Acknowledgment and Signatures: Formal acknowledgment of the review by both parties

Optional Sections

1. Salary Review: Include when the performance review is linked to compensation decisions

2. Project-Specific Assessment: Include for employees involved in specific major projects during the review period

3. Leadership Assessment: Include for employees in management positions

4. Client/Stakeholder Feedback: Include when external feedback is relevant to the role

5. Technical Skills Assessment: Include for technical roles requiring specific skill evaluation

6. Team Performance: Include for team leaders or where team contribution is significant

7. Innovation and Initiative: Include for roles where creativity and problem-solving are key expectations

Suggested Schedules

1. Performance Metrics Data: Detailed data and statistics supporting the performance assessment

2. Previous Review Summary: Summary of the last performance review for reference

3. Training Record: List of completed training and development activities

4. Job Description: Current job description for reference

5. Performance Improvement Plan: Detailed plan if performance improvement is required

6. Employee Self-Assessment: Self-evaluation form completed by the employee

7. Objective Setting Framework: Framework and guidelines for setting new objectives
